    Not sure if you can check in for the Sig at the airport or not or whether it is just the MGM Grand.

    The taxi will stop at the gatehouse where you give them your name and they will tell you which tower you are in.

    No need for the tunnel to get to the Sig. You need Swenson to Koval.

    You can try the getting married card, but so many thousands of people get married in Vegas that it's nothing unusual.
